源码网商城,靠谱的源码在线交易网站 我的订单 购物车 帮助

源码网商城

深入理解linux中close与shutdown的区别

  • 时间:2021-05-12 20:16 编辑: 来源: 阅读:
  • 扫一扫,手机访问
摘要:深入理解linux中close与shutdown的区别
1. close  把描述符的引用计数减一,仅在该计数变为0时才关闭套接字。而shutdown可以并以不管引用计数就激发TCP的正常连接终止序列 2. close终止读和写两个方向的数据传送,而shutdown可以指定哪个方向被关闭,读端还是写端还是两个都关闭 int shutdown(int sockfd, int howto); howto参数的值 SHUT_RD  只关闭读这一半 SHUT_WD  只关闭写这一半 SHUT_RDWR 连接的读半部和写半部都关闭
  • 全部评论(0)
联系客服
客服电话:
400-000-3129
微信版

扫一扫进微信版
返回顶部